Review: KitchenAid Immersion Blender

Today I'm going to be reviewing the handiest gadget I own, the KitchenAid Immersion Blender. I bought this tool around 4 years ago and find myself reaching for it more and more these days. I don't think I've every adjusted the speed, in fact I didn't notice it had adjustable speed until my husband pointed it out - maybe I should read manuals more! This hasn't ever made a difference to anything I've used it for, it is always perfect. From mashed potatoes, to soups to baby food, smoothies, milkshakes getting the lumps out of a bad batch of béchamel - this is your new best friend. Here is some blurb from KitchenAid's website:

"The 3-Speed Hand Blender let's you blend, crush, chop, puree and whisk. Simply choose the appropriate speed for your ingredients. The chopper attachment is great for processing harder cheeses, nuts and creating graham cracker crusts. The included whisk attachment whips creams and egg whites to fluffy peaks."
